Free Zone Corporate Entities
There are two types of free zone corporate entities. They are;
- Free Zone Establishment (FZE)
- Free Zone Company(FZC)
These are special economic areas where an investor can have special tax fee status and trade conditions. The major difference between FZE and FZC is in the number of shareholders. ‘Establishment’ is a formation of a single shareholder whereas a ‘company’ generally demands two or more shareholders.

Requirements of a Free Zone Company Formation
Type of company
The first step towards starting a free zone company is that you need to fix the type of company, so as the free zone. The free zone may vary according to the type of company you are heading to.
Trade name
A trade name is the identity of your business and it should be according to the conventions mentioned by the free zone that you are operating.
Business license
The next step toward creating a free zone company is applying for a business license. There are various licenses for different free zones The three types of licenses are
- Commercial license
- Professional license
- Industrial license
Office space
Once the license has been obtained, you need to fix the office space. You can either own an office or can take it for rent.
Approvals
The investors need to get all the approvals from different authorities before a license can be issued. This process approximately takes 2-3 weeks. The whole process of starting a company takes approximately four weeks. You can have your free zone formation within 4 weeks. Forming a free zone company is as simple as it.
Documents Required for Free Zone Company Formation in Dubai
The documents needed for each free zone may vary. Here is an estimated list of documents needed for free zone company formation.
- Application license form.
- Business card.
- Business plan outlay.
- MOA(Memorandum of Association) and AOA(Articles of Association)
- Passport copies.
- Banking reference and license of the partners existing business if required.
